The best prompts follow a structure: scene setting → camera movement → subject details → physics/lighting. For example: "Cinematic wide shot, slow dolly forward, a samurai standing in a field of tall grass, wind bending the grass and flowing through his cloak, golden hour backlight with lens flare." Keep it under 200 words. Mentioning specific physics (cloth draping, fluid dynamics, particle effects) unlocks Seedance 2.5's strongest capabilities.
